Ordinals
beta
Address 1HAeQJUpppim8RTg5WVoTWVu1siZiQfAY1
sat balance
3117
outputs
08acfe1a716b9ba6e0ea839c89a92e9945f8d3130480ec07f2a2076b423b4149:1